A late Victorian small silver footed bowl, the circular form with scroll pierced rim above an embossed floral band and similarly decorated border to foot, hallmarked Josiah Williams & Co (George Maudsley Jackson), London 1893, height 3 (7.5cm). Together with an Edwardian silver mounted and glass quaich bowl, hallmarked William Comyns & Sons, London 1901, and a later shell butter dish, hallmarked David Hollander & Son, Birmingham 1971. Weighable silver 8.15 ozt (253.6 grams). (3). Dimensions: Condition Report: All three pieces displaying some general surface wear, marks, scratches and tarnishing commensurate with their age and use. Victorian bowl with a few small holes in the embossed decoration. Hallmarks with some heavy rubbing but still legible. Glass quaich bowl with several chips around foot rim. Hallmarks on mount slightly cut off along bottom edge but clearly legible. Shell dish in good overall condition. Hallmarks clear, maker's mark a little rubbed.
